Accident-induced absence from work and wage ladders | Institute for Fiscal Studies How do temporary spells of absence from work affect individuals’ labor trajectory? To answer this question, we augment a ‘wage ladder’ model.

How do short spells of absence from work affect individuals’ labor trajectory?

Our new IFS WP documents that workers forego opportunities to climb the wage ladder.

Accident-induced Absence from Work and Wage Ladders
by M. Bisztray, A. Bíró, J. G. da Fonseca, T.L. Molnár
